CVE-2021-26829
OpenPLC ScadaBR Cross-site Scripting Vulnerability
Does this matter?
Known to be exploited in the wild (CISA KEV, CISA remediation deadline 19 December 2025). Treat as an emergency change: patch or isolate now, then hunt for prior compromise.
Description
OpenPLC ScadaBR through 0.9.1 on Linux and through 1.12.4 on Windows allows stored XSS via system_settings.shtm.

CISA notes
Apply mitigations per vendor instructions, follow applicable BOD 22-01 guidance for cloud services, or discontinue use of the product if mitigations are unavailable. This vulnerability could affect an open-source component, third-party library, protocol, or proprietary implementation that could be used by different products.
